/* CSS Document */

body { margin-left: 0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; }
body,table,td,th,p,div,input { font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 11px; color: #666666;}

a.menulink:link{color: #666666; text-decoration: none }
a.menulink:visited{color: #666666; text-decoration: none }
a.menulink:hover{color: #890222; text-decoration: underline; }

a.textlink:link{color: #890222; text-decoration: none; }
a.textlink:visited{color: #890222; text-decoration: none; }
a.textlink:hover{color: #890222; text-decoration: underline; }

a.redlink:link{color: red; text-decoration: underline; font-weight: normal; }
a.redlink:visited{color: red; text-decoration: underline; font-weight: normal; }
a.redlink:hover{color: red; text-decoration: underline; font-weight: normal; }

.mainarea{ padding-left: 45px; padding-right: 45px; padding-top: 10px; padding-bottom: 10px;}
.pageheading { color: #890222; font-weight: bold; font-size: 18px; padding-left: 45px; padding-top: 7px;}
.pageheadingnoindent { color: #890222; font-weight: bold; font-size: 18px; }
.subheading { color: #890222; font-weight: bold; font-size: 12px; }
.minorheading { color: #890222; font-weight: bold; font-size: 11px; }

.style2 { color: #666666; }
.style3 { color: #666666}
.style4 { color: #666666; font-size: 11px;}
.style5 { color: #FFFFFF; font-weight: bold; }

.textbox10 { color: #666666; font-size: 11px; border: 1px solid #666666; padding: 1px; }
.textbox11 { color: #000000; font-size: 11px; border: 1px solid #666666; padding: 1px; }
.logintexterr{ color: red; font-weight: bold; }
.rednotice{ color: #FF0000; font-weight: bold; border: 1px solid #ff0000;}
.button {color: #666666; border: 1px solid #666666;}
.sectionheader{ height: 25px;}
.sectionheader2{ height: 25px; background-image: url(../images/section_header.gif); background-repeat: repeat-x; border: 1px solid #666666;}
.sectiontext { color: #666666; padding-left: 2px; padding-right: 2px; border-top: 1px solid #c3c3c3; }
.sectiontextnoborder { color: #666666; padding-left: 2px; padding-right: 2px; }

.orderview1 {background-color: #eeeeee; padding: 5px;}
.orderview2 {background-color: #ffffff; padding: 5px; }

.formfield { padding-top: 5px; padding-bottom: 5px; padding-right: 10px; width: 205px; vertical-align: top; }
.asterix { font: Tahoma, Arial, Helvetica, sans-serif; size: 11px; color: #890222; }
.imagebox { border: 1px solid #666666; }

.displaytable { border-width: 1px;	border-style: solid; border-color: #999999;	border-collapse: collapse; }
.displaytableheading {	font-family: Tahoma, Arial, Helvetica, sans-serif;	font-size: 11px; font-weight: bold;	color: #ffffff;	padding: 5px; border-width: 1px; border-style: solid; border-color: white; background-color: #999999; }
.displaytablerow1 {font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; background-color: #eaeaea; }
.displaytablerow2 {font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; background-color: #ffffff; }
.displaytablecontent1 {padding: 5px; border-width: 1px; padding: 5px; border-style: solid;	border-color: white;}
.displaytablecontent2 {padding: 5px; border-width: 1px; padding: 5px; border-style: solid; border-color: #eaeaea;}
.displaytablehighlight {font-family: Tahoma, Arial, Helvetica, sans-serif; cursor: pointer; font-size: 11px; font-weight: normal; color: #000000; background-color: #95a7dd; }

.featuretable { border-width: 1px;	border-style: solid; border-color: #999999;	border-collapse: collapse; }
.featuretableheading {	font-family: Tahoma, Arial, Helvetica, sans-serif;	font-size: 14px; font-weight: bold;	color: #ffffff;	padding: 5px; border-width: 1px; border-style: solid; border-color: white; background-color: #890222; }
.featuretablecontent {padding: 5px; border-width: 1px; padding: 5px; border-style: solid;	border-color: white;}

.castable { border: 1px solid #999999; border-collapse: collapse; }
.castableheading { padding: 5px; font-weight: bold; color: #ffffff; background-color: #999999; }
.castablecell { padding: 5px; border: 1px solid #eaeaea; }

a.headinglink:link{color: #ffffff; text-decoration: none; }
a.headinglink:visited{color: #ffffff; text-decoration: none; }
a.headinglink:hover{color: #ffffff; text-decoration: underline; }

